What companies run services between Valencia, Spain and Las Arenas beach, Spain?

Metro Valencia operates a subway from Colón to Marítim every 15 minutes. Tickets cost €1–2 and the journey takes 8 min. Alternatively, EMT Valencia operates a bus from Marqués del Túria - Mestre Gozalbo to Eugènia Viñes - Passeig de Neptú every 20 minutes. Tickets cost €2 and the journey takes 22 min.
